Transaction 40fefaf8a62f833dcdc96f49e40d16baa28fd137d2a67e14e15a2bd803c7cd96
1 Input
2 Outputs
- 40fefaf8a62f833dcdc96f49e40d16baa28fd137d2a67e14e15a2bd803c7cd96:0
- 40fefaf8a62f833dcdc96f49e40d16baa28fd137d2a67e14e15a2bd803c7cd96:1
value 105972793
address 3FqLiLrWRu4SyNdqWqwp9xnE617zuRrn9Q
value 4000000
address 17FUrV846XPu3jYV4syMGxjsjjnrPuzCuH